In the event of virtualisation of teaching due to the closure of face-to-face activities for reasons of force majeure, the following are proposed:
1. Modifications to the contents
No changes in content are envisaged.
2. Methodologies
Teaching methodologies that will be maintained
The following teaching methodologies will be maintained:
- Expository teaching (lectures) in virtual format through institutional platforms.
- Case studies, for which telematic support and tutoring will be reinforced.
- Lectures
Teaching methodologies to be modified
The following teaching methodologies will be modified:
- Mixed test: it will be carried out telematically, making use of institutional platforms.
- Initial activities: these will be carried out through small group discussion seminars using the institutional platforms.
- Directed discussion. These will be carried out through small group discussion seminars using the institutional platforms. Participation in thematic discussion forums created for this purpose will be encouraged, as well as through the implementation of self-assessment activities/dynamics (using Socratic resources such as Kahoot).
The following methodologies will be dropped:
- Laboratory practicals. If this cannot be carried out due to the health situation, the late-night contents will be dealt with/compensated telematically through the use of audiovisual support material.
3. Mechanisms for personalised attention to students
- E-mail: Daily. To be used to make queries, request virtual meetings to resolve doubts and follow up on tutored work.
- Moodle: Daily. According to the needs of the students. Thematic forums associated with the modules of the subject will be created, where the necessary consultations can be made, as well as "specific activity forums" to develop the "Directed Discussions", through which the development of the theoretical contents of the subject will be put into practice.
- MS Teams: 1 session per week in a large group for the revision of the theoretical contents and the tutored work in the time slot assigned to the subject in the faculty's calendar of classrooms.
1 to 2 sessions per week (or more depending on student demand) in a small group (up to 6 people), for monitoring and support in carrying out the "tutored work". This dynamic allows for a standardised and adjusted monitoring of the students' learning needs in order to develop the work of the subject.
4. Modifications in the evaluation
No modification is proposed, except for the percentage assigned to the continuous assessment of the practical sessions, which will be included in the general continuous assessment of all the telematic activities of the subject (thus increasing to 20%). The mixed test will also represent 40% as will the case study work (40%).
Observations on assessment:
The same requirements for passing the subject are maintained except for the requirement of attendance at a minimum of 70% of the practical sessions, which will be required for the set of telematic sessions that are developed.
